Comparing Complementary and Alternative Medicine Use with or without Including Prayer as a Modality in a Local and Diverse United States Jurisdiction

How CAM is defined matters in gauging the utilization of this non-mainstream collection of therapies. Given that surveillance and/or benchmarking data are often used to inform resource allocation and planning decisions, results from the present study suggest that when prayer is included as part of the CAM definition, utilization/volume estimates of its use increased correspondingly, especially among non-White residents of the region.
